We're investigating the Toltec Connector for Outlook.
This allows an IMAP server (Cyrus in our situation) to give near MS Exchange
functionality. Calendars can be shared, however they currently require
each user to share their own calendar by manually typing in the users they
want to share it with. For a 40 user company this could potentially be a
large task not to mention possible errors with entry.
Does cyrus support an 'everyone' option, where I could set it
so that everyone's Calendar folder is visible to anyone authenticated to our
server? As far as I've seen so far (which is brief!) it seems to be on a
per-user basis. We're using Web-cyradm and MySQL for user details, so
potentially a script could be written to suck out all account names and on a
cron job update the ACLs for everyone to include everyone - but I see that as a
messy kludge.
